		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Pogang in Bau is referred to a type of lemang without the banana leaf.  It used smaller bamboo. And if I am not mistaken, it is not cook with santan. It is usually cooked during Gawai for offering to the Spirit, and for the guest. The type you shown is called &#8216;limang&#8217;, borrowed from Malay words. As &#8216;pogang&#8217; can be quite stiff and bland without the santan, nowadays the Bidayuh prefer to cook limang.</p>
